Gloria Banks

June 22, 1952 — January 29, 2021

Gloria D. Banks was born June 22, 1952 in Indianola, Mississippi, the daughter of James and Lueberta Banks.

Gloria was a very beautiful, loving, caring mother, grandmother and sister. She enjoyed fishing, cooking, dancing and spending time with family and friends. Gloria loved being a grandmother and singing gospel. She had a heart of gold and gave food and shelter to anyone in need. Well done good and faithful servant.

Gloria was preceded in death by her son, Deon Banks; parents, James Sr. and Luberta Banks; brothers, James and Stanley Banks; sisters, Patricia Knight and Sherry Houston.

She leaves to cherish her memory three granddaughters, Deontanette Banks, Marion, Indiana, Carmesha and Cornequa Knight, both of Saginaw, Michigan; great-grandchildren, Xavier, Iyanna, Layla McRae, all of Marion, Indiana, MyQuavis, Jayden, Julian Knight, all of Saginaw, Michigan; sisters, Doris Quinn, Elkhart, Indiana, Overzenia Laster, Barbara Watkins, Kimberly Hardy, Shirley McClung, all of Saginaw, Michigan, Linda Nunn, Plymouth, Michigan, Pearline Surles, Texas; brothers, Eddie Knight, Saginaw, Michigan, Sylvester (Teresa) Banks, Jody (Leslie) Nunn, both of Grand Rapids, Michigan, Cleveland (Santoria) Kendricks, Saginaw, Michigan; goddaughters, Fredricka Donald, Karen Roberson; many nieces, nephews, cousins, other relatives and friends, including special friends Adrian “Fish” Blakes and Janice “BJ” West.
